Cluster information : Rimocidin


close this sectionCompound

Entry nameRimocidin
PKS TypeTypeI modular
ClassificationPolyene Macrolide
Starter UnitRimocidin: butyryl-CoA
CE-108: acetyl-CoA
Chain Length14
Sugar Unitmycosamine
ActivityAntifungal
CompositionC39H61NO14

close this sectionReference

Starter unit choice determines the production of two tetraene macrolides, rimocidin and CE-108, in Streptomyces diastaticus var. 108.
Seco EM, Perez-Zuniga FJ, Rolon MS, Malpartida F
[PMID: 15123265]Chem Biol. 11 (2004) 357-66
A tailoring activity is responsible for generating polyene amide derivatives in Streptomyces diastaticus var. 108.
Seco EM, Fotso S, Laatsch H, Malpartida F
[PMID: 16242652]Chem Biol. 12 (2005) 1093-101
Initiation of polyene macrolide biosynthesis: interplay between polyketide synthase domains and modules as revealed via domain swapping, mutagenesis, and heterologous complementation.
Heia S, Borgos SE, Sletta H, Escudero L, Seco EM, Malpartida F, Ellingsen TE, Zotchev SB
[PMID: 21821762]Appl Environ Microbiol. 77 (2011) 6982-90
